site stats

Pyspark sql join on multiple columns

WebMar 18, 2024 · Quantitative, qualitative, mixed-methods research planning, design, and analysis experience. I am always interested in talking about data science and research design and analysis! Connect with me ... WebWe just need to use a JOIN clause with more than one condition by using the AND operator after the first condition. In our example, we use this condition: p.course_code=e.course_code AND p.student_id=e.student_id. In the first part, we use the student_id column from the enrollment table and student_id from the payment table.

Combining columns into a single column of arrays in PySpark

WebMar 9, 2024 · Sometimes, we want to do complicated things to a column or multiple columns. We can think of this as a map operation on a PySpark dataframe to a single column or multiple columns. Although Spark SQL functions do solve many use cases when it comes to column creation, I use Spark UDF whenever I need more matured … WebOct 21, 2024 · How to combine multi columns into one in pyspark. Ask Question Asked 1 year, 5 months ago. Modified 1 year, ... You can join columns and format them as you … kaiser 24 hour pharmacy phone number https://mickhillmedia.com

Craig Pfeifer, PhD - Quantitative Scientist (Data Scientist) - LinkedIn

WebDec 5, 2024 · Multiple DataFrame joining using SQL expression. join () method is used to join two Dataframes together based on condition specified in PySpark Azure … WebMar 5, 2024 · To combine the columns fname and lname into a single column of arrays, use the array (~) method: we are using the alias (~) method to assign a label to the … WebDec 21, 2024 · org.apache.spark.sql.AnalysisException: Union can only be performed on tables with the same number of columns, but the first table has 7 columns and the … law in motion marmora

PySpark groupby multiple columns Working and Example with Advant…

Category:Join in pyspark (Merge) inner, outer, right, left join

Tags:Pyspark sql join on multiple columns

Pyspark sql join on multiple columns

How to join on multiple columns in Pyspark? Gang of Coders

WebDec 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Webdf1− Dataframe1.; df2– Dataframe2.; on− Columns (names) to join on.Must be found in both df1 and df2. how– type of join needs to be performed – ‘left’, ‘right’, ‘outer’, ‘inner’, …

Pyspark sql join on multiple columns

Did you know?

WebFeb 7, 2024 · Here, I will use the ANSI SQL syntax to do join on multiple tables, in order to use PySpark SQL, first, we should create a temporary view for all our DataFrames and … WebDec 9, 2024 · In a Sort Merge Join partitions are sorted on the join key prior to the join operation. Broadcast Joins. Broadcast joins happen when Spark decides to send a …

WebJan 19, 2024 · In this scenario, we are going to import the pyspark and pyspark SQL modules and create a spark session as below: import pyspark from pyspark.sql import SparkSession spark = SparkSession.builder.appName('Performing Vertical Stacking').getOrCreate() Step 3: Create a schema. Here we create a StructField for each … WebDec 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…

Web10 years df will have just 3650 records not that many to worry about. As long as you're using Spark version 2.1 or higher, you can exploit the fact that we can use column values as … WebSoftware Associate-Data Engineer,Digital Ambassador and Pursuing MSc Data Science with 3+ years of experience in Information Technology includes Google cloud, Apache Spark and Big Data Hadoop Eco System. Adaptive person with Big Data technologies experience while part of project to successful implementation. Experience includes Oracle SQL , …

WebFeb 7, 2024 · Here, I will use the ANSI SQL syntax to do join on multiple tables, in order to use PySpark SQL, first, we should create a temporary view for all our DataFrames and then use spark.sql() to execute the SQL expression. Using this, you can write a PySpark SQL expression by joining multiple DataFrames, selecting the columns you want, and join ...

WebIn order to concatenate two columns in pyspark we will be using concat() Function. We look at an example on how to join or concatenate two string columns in pyspark (two … kaiser 24 hour pharmacy harbor cityWebExperienced Data Analyst with 10+ years in the Data Center space. I use data to help perform capacity management, report and control business KPIs and improve … law in motion hearingWebDec 19, 2024 · Output: we can join the multiple columns by using join () function using conditional operator. Syntax: dataframe.join (dataframe1, (dataframe.column1== dataframe1.column1) & (dataframe.column2== dataframe1.column2)) where, dataframe is the first dataframe. dataframe1 is the second dataframe. l.a. winners